J. D. “Sandy” McClatchy died on April 10, 2018, in Manhattan at the age of 72. He was a longtime professor of English at Yale and editor of the Yale Review.
The New York Times carried a full story on April 11, 2018.
Read the tribute published in the July/August issue of the Yale Alumni Magazine.